Hhohho Region is a region of Eswatini in the country's north west, whose administrative center is the national capital, Mbabane. It has a population of 320,651 as of the 2017 census across an area of about 3,625 square kilometers.

Hhohho is a region of Eswatini, located in the north western part of the country. It has an area of 3,625.17 km2, a population of 320,651 (2017), and is divided into 14 tinkhundla. The administrative center is the national capital of Mbabane.
